Understanding the Role of Eggplant
Eggplant serves as the star ingredient in these Crispy Veggie Chips due to its unique texture and ability to absorb flavors. When thinly sliced, it becomes perfectly crispy while still retaining a light chew that contrasts beautifully with its savory seasonings. Selecting a fresh, firm eggplant with smooth skin ensures the best results, as overripe or blemished varieties may become mushy during baking.
Besides its remarkable texture, eggplant is a powerhouse of nutrients, including fiber, vitamins, and minerals. Its low-calorie profile makes it an excellent choice for guilt-free snacking. Additionally, the natural moisture content in eggplant helps achieve that delightful crunch once dried out properly, making it both a healthy and satisfying option.
Seasoning Secrets for Maximum Flavor
The seasoning blend is crucial in elevating the flavor of these crispy chips. Garlic powder and onion powder complement the earthiness of eggplant beautifully, while paprika adds a mild smokiness that enhances the overall taste. Feel free to experiment with your favorite spices; cayenne pepper can introduce a kick, and dried herbs like oregano or thyme can provide an aromatic complexity.
Another key to flavorful chips is the oil. Olive oil not only helps to crisp up the eggplant but also adds richness. For a different taste, you could substitute with avocado oil or coconut oil, both of which have high smoke points and will help achieve that desired crunch without smoking out your kitchen.
Serving Suggestions and Variations
While these Crispy Eggplant Veggie Chips are delightful on their own, pairing them with a dip can elevate your snacking experience. A creamy hummus, zesty ranch, or even a tangy tzatziki would be fantastic accompaniments that offer contrasting textures and flavors. It also allows for a delightful party platter—just arrange the chips alongside an array of colorful dips.
For a twist, consider adding toppings right before baking. A sprinkle of nutritional yeast can create a cheesy flavor without the dairy, making them even more appealing to plant-based eaters. You could also coat them lightly with parmesan cheese for a savory touch; just remember to adjust your salt accordingly to avoid over-seasoning.
Ingredients
Ingredients
For the Crispy Chips
- 1 large eggplant
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
Feel free to adjust the seasonings to your liking!
Instructions
Instructions
Prepare the Eggplant
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Slice the eggplant into thin rounds, about 1/8 inch thick. Lay the slices on a paper towel and sprinkle lightly with salt. Let them sit for 10 minutes to draw out moisture.
Season the Chips
Rinse the eggplant rounds under cold water to remove excess salt, then pat them dry with a paper towel. In a large bowl, combine the olive oil,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, salt, and pepper. Toss the eggplant slices in the mixture until evenly coated.
Bake the Chips
Arrange the seasoned eggplant slices in a single layer on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for 30 minutes or until golden and crispy, flipping halfway through for even cooking.
Serve and Enjoy
Remove the chips from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. Enjoy your crispy eggplant veggie chips with a dip or on their own!
Store any leftover chips in an airtight container for up to 2 days.

Storage and Reheating Tips
These Crispy Eggplant Veggie Chips can be stored in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. To maintain crispiness, avoid placing them in the refrigerator, as moisture can lead to sogginess. You can place a paper towel at the bottom of the container to absorb any excess moisture, preserving the chips' texture for longer.
If you find that your chips have lost their crunch, you can easily revive them.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and spread the chips in a single layer on a baking sheet. Bake for about 5-10 minutes, watching closely to prevent burning. This quick reheating will re-crisp them, ensuring that every bite is satisfying.
Scaling the Recipe
This recipe is highly scalable, making it ideal for a large gathering or simply for meal prep. When increasing the amount of eggplant, ensure you don't overcrowd the baking sheet. Chips should be baked in a single layer to guarantee even cooking and adequate air circulation; otherwise, you may risk them becoming soggy rather than crispy.
If you’re planning to make multiple batches, consider varying the seasoning blends for a colorful assortment of flavors. Label each batch to easily identify them when serving. This not only creates an interesting taste experience but also encourages others to enjoy a variety of healthy snacking options.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
One common issue with homemade veggie chips is uneven crispiness. To avoid this, make sure your eggplant slices are uniformly cut. Invest in a mandoline slicer for perfect thickness each time, ensuring that they all cook evenly. If any chips emerge chewier than crispy, use the reheating method mentioned to perfect their texture.
Another potential pitfall is using too much oil, which can lead to greasy chips instead of a light crunch. Stick to the recommended amount of olive oil, and if you desire a thinner coating, use a sprayer to evenly distribute the oil without oversaturating the eggplant. This method can help you control the amount used while still achieving that crispy result.
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use other vegetables for this recipe?
Absolutely! Zucchini and sweet potatoes also make great chips.
→ How can I make these chips spicier?
Add some cayenne pepper or chili powder to the seasoning mix for a spicy kick.
→ What should I serve with these chips?
These chips are great with hummus, guacamole, or any dip of your choice.
→ Can I fry the eggplant chips instead of baking?
Yes, frying will give you a different texture, but baking is healthier and just as delicious!
